Job description
The Wellbeing Specialist will work closely with the Head of Wellbeing and Therapies to develop, deliver and oversee a programme of wellbeing and therapy services which will see the Hospice reach people in the communities in which it serves, and that access to these services is equitable and fair in its reach.
This work will build relationships, links and projects that will:
Ensure equitable access for local communities to St Catherines services and support
Work to broaden access to hospice services, reflected in a change in patient profile that more accurately reflects the local population and ensures we are an inclusive organisation
Develop sustainable and reciprocal partnerships with other organisations and community groups.
You will be part of a multi professional team collectively responsible for planning and delivering responsive, compassionate and effective wellbeing and therapy support to the patients and families referred to StCH. This will include planning, coordinating and facilitating the delivery of group and community settings.
Youll work closely with our Wellbeing and Therapy team, Community, Inpatient Unit and contribute to a positive working environment with an emphasis on innovation, teamwork and co-operation. You will take responsibility for creating and maintaining a culture of continuous improvement, ensuring high quality standards are maintained.
About us
St Catherines Hospice is a respected local charity providing specialist hospice care alongside statutory service partners (GPs, District nursing etc) across West Sussex and East Surrey.
We provide care in communities across Surrey and Sussex which are richly diverse and we want to reflect that in everything we do.
